Overview

The MSc in Biomedical Engineering at the University of Strathclyde is a comprehensive program designed to equip students with advanced knowledge and skills in the vital field of biomedical engineering. This rigorous course offers a deep dive into the integration of engineering principles with medical sciences, emphasizing the design and development of medical devices, rehabilitation engineering, and the application of engineering techniques to solve clinical problems. As one of the leading institutions in the UK, Strathclyde is committed to providing students with an education that combines theoretical and practical elements, ensuring they are well-prepared for a variety of career paths in this innovative and rapidly-evolving sector.
Throughout the program, students will engage with a rich curriculum that covers a wide array of topics, including biomaterials, medical imaging, biomechanics, and signal processing. The courses are meticulously structured to foster critical thinking and problem-solving abilities. Key modules may include "Biomedical Instrumentation," "Tissue Engineering," and "Bioinformatics," among others. These courses are designed to not only impart essential theoretical knowledge but also to provide hands-on experience through laboratory work and projects that reflect real-world challenges in biomedical engineering.

To be eligible for this esteemed program, applicants should possess a relevant undergraduate degree or equivalent in engineering, science, or a related discipline. Proficiency in English is essential, with minimum scores required in standardized tests such as IELTS (minimum 6.5 overall), PTE (minimum 60), or TOEFL (minimum 80). These requirements ensure that students can engage fully with the curriculum and participate in collaborative projects. Additionally, a strong academic background, along with any relevant work experience, can enhance an applicant's chances of admission to this competitive program.
